Pacific Ridge is a 2-tract neighborhood of Des Moines, WA and houses 10,886 people. The Eviction Risk Score is 7.9/10, in the Elevated tier. Cost burden runs roughly two in three against 39.8% citywide, putting Pacific Ridge 27.0% over its own city.
The severe-burden share is 35%. Those renters are past the 50% mark, and they miss rent for reasons that have nothing to do with willingness to pay. The dominant input is rent-regulation exposure at 8.4/10. Running hot is tenant-organizing strength at 8.2/10.
Well under the midpoint is supply constraint, at 2.1/10. The poverty rate is 18%. Judgments in high-poverty tracts are collectible far less often than the filing statistics suggest.
Filings are well documented here: 862 across 2 observed tracts. The worst year on record was 2008, when filings touched 15.7% of renter households. The most recent observed rate, 2.1% in 2013, is well off that peak.

How does Pacific Ridge compare to Des Moines overall?
Pacific Ridge scores 1.3 points higher than Des Moines overall (6.6/10). Renters spend 67% of income on rent vs 40% citywide. Average rent: $1,838 vs $1,799.
Q3
What is the average rent in Pacific Ridge?
Average gross rent in Pacific Ridge is $1,838/month (pop-weighted across 2 census tracts, ACS 5-year 2023). 67% of renter households are cost-burdened.
Q4
What percentage of Pacific Ridge residents are renters?
56% of Pacific Ridge households are renter-occupied (vs 39% in Des Moines). The neighborhood has 10,886 residents.
